X-Git-Url: http://developer.intra2net.com/git/?p=libt2n;a=blobdiff_plain;f=example-codegen%2FTODO;h=c166d7efce6fbec0a29980bcc275d2deea2c7e60;hp=39fc78d6f5a0d037ce8ec741a07944c403ece2af;hb=53b891edf1f624b1c90eef94185a142cd067bdf8;hpb=7f43535628b782bd82c4fbdd1b8f23d7782b0337 diff --git a/example-codegen/TODO b/example-codegen/TODO index 39fc78d..c166d7e 100644 --- a/example-codegen/TODO +++ b/example-codegen/TODO @@ -14,9 +14,16 @@ now we use the first solution for codegen - but not overwriting output files if they are the same) - howto include the part after "# always the same:" in all makefiles (using the codegenerator) (we now use make's include) -- lib name should be group name + suffix/prefix +- lib name should be group name + suffix/prefix ?! + user should have complete control => no default suffix/perfix + headers should be installed in pkgincludedir? maybe yes on the other hand + the user can pass the directory to configure via --includedir - the example should not get installed (but still it should show how to build a lib that gets installed :-( (overwriting install: doesn't work) + => perhaps split libt2n package into 3 packages? + libt2n + libt2n-example-codegen + libt2n-example-libusage - at the moment make dist from within a clean source will not work (this is related to the nodist problem / old automake version) this is caused by BUILT_SOURCES not working for make dist(check?) @@ -29,6 +36,4 @@ now we use the first solution => how to add dependency on BUILT_SOURCES for dist? the real problem is that make dist should not depend on BUILT_SOURCES unfortunately we can't fix this as long as we use a old automake version -- add (standalone) example using generated client library - (=> depends on installed example) - example consists of: the same client.cpp but provides a configure.in and Makefile.am + (DISTFILES includes generated files we would like to mark as noinst)